CPCTC stands for “Corresponding Parts of Congruent Triangles are Congruent”
This means if two triangles are proven to be congruent their parts, whether sides or angles will be congruent.
the two angles, BTA and ATC share the same vertex, T (the vertex is the middle letter) [vertex is where the two lines for the angles meet]
since the two triangles are congruent, and the angle that is mentioned is a shared vertex, that means the two angles are congruent.

Since this is a right triangle, we can us the Pythagorean theorem
a^2 + b^2 = c^2
3^2 + 14^2 = JL ^2
9+196 = JL ^2
205 = JL ^2
Taking the square root of each side
sqrt(205) = JL
14.31782106 = JL
To 2 decimal places
14.32
